Why pH-balanced Unscented Soaps are Important for Baby Skin

Taking care of your little one’s delicate skin is key. Using pH-balanced, unscented soaps can help ensure it stays healthy and hydrated. Baby’s skin is more sensitive than adults, which means that the harsh chemicals found in some soaps can easily irritate and dry out their delicate skin.
For this reason, it’s important to use baby-safe ingredients when choosing a soap for them. pH-balanced, unscented soaps contain milder cleansers that are gentle on baby’s skin while still effectively cleaning away dirt and bacteria. These types of soaps also contain moisturizers that help keep baby’s skin hydrated and nourished without the risk of irritation or drying out due to fragrances or harsh detergents.
By carefully selecting a pH-balanced, unscented soap for your baby, you can ensure they receive a gentle cleansing with ingredients that won’t disturb their delicate balance of natural oils.
How to Choose the Right Soap for Baby

Selecting the right soap for your little one is like finding a pot of gold at the end of a rainbow – it’ll make their skin shine and glimmer!
When selecting a soap for baby, you should look for pH-balanced unscented options as these are gentler on delicate skin.
You’ll want to be sure to read the labels and check for any potentially irritating ingredients or fragrances. It’s best to avoid synthetic chemicals such as parabens, sulfates, phthalates, and artificial colors/fragrances.
Organic soaps with safe ingredients are an ideal option if available in your area. Additionally, you may wish to opt for natural oils such as coconut or olive oil which have been proven to help moisturize baby’s skin without causing irritation.

Benefits of pH-balanced Unscented Soaps

Discovering the perfect soap for your little one can give you a feeling of accomplishment and a sense of relief, knowing that their delicate skin will be cared for without any harsh irritants. pH-balanced unscented soaps are known to be especially beneficial for babies’ sensitive skin, as they contain natural ingredients with a gentle formula.
Such soaps are designed to avoid over-drying or irritating skin while still being effective cleansers. The pH balanced formula helps maintain the natural protective layer on a baby’s skin, allowing them to retain their natural moisture and stay soft and healthy.
Unscented soaps also provide more control over which fragrances may affect your child’s skin, making it easier to avoid potential allergens or other sensitivities. Furthermore, these products often contain fewer preservatives than scented soaps, meaning there’s less risk of irritation from synthetic additives.
What to Look Out for When Using Unscented Soaps

Though unscented soaps can be beneficial for babies’ sensitive skin, it’s important to remain vigilant when using them.
Just as a parent wouldn’t trust a stranger with their child, knowing the ingredients of any product is paramount in ensuring its safety.
For instance, some products labeled ‘unscented’ may still contain fragrances or other additives that could potentially cause irritation.
To ensure gentle and safe daily bathing for babies, look out for soaps that are specifically made from pH-balanced and natural ingredients like coconut oil and aloe vera.
These botanical extracts provide moisture and nourishment to the baby’s delicate skin without stripping away its natural oils – something regular soap tends to do.
Additionally, it’s important to find an unscented soap free of preservatives, parabens, phthalates and sulfates which might disrupt hormone balance or otherwise irritate the infant’s skin.
